Inverse of a $2\times 2$ matrix


$\displaystyle \bold A ^{-1} \quad\quad\quad\quad \bold A \quad\quad$ $\textstyle =$ $\displaystyle \ \quad\bold I$ (110)
$\displaystyle \frac{1}{ad-bc}
\left[
\begin{array}{rr}
d & -b \\
-c & a
\end{array}\right]
\quad
\left[
\begin{array}{rr}
a & b \\
c & d
\end{array}\right]$ $\textstyle =$ $\displaystyle \left[
\begin{array}{rr}
1 & 0 \\
0 & 1
\end{array}\right]$ (111)
